The Indian Premier League (IPL) is one of the most popular tournaments in the world.

Like European football leagues, the IPL franchises have been paying double or triple the market value to acquire the services of players in the auctions. In this article, we will look at the expensive players from the last five IPL seasons and how they fare for their respective franchises in that season.

How Did Expensive Buys in the Last Five IPL Seasons Fare?

In the last five seasons of IPL, a mix of overseas and domestic players has become the most expensive purchases. Some of the highest-paid players have disappointed fans and bettors alike in IPL betting, while a few had decent campaigns.

Here are the most expensive auction buys in the last five IPL seasons:

 Sam Curran – IPL 2023 Auction

England all-rounder Sam Curran became the most expensive cricketer in IPL history when he was bought for a whopping ₹18.50 crore by Punjab Kings in the IPL 2023 auction. However, he had an ordinary IPL 2023. Curran played in all 14 matches, amassing 276 runs. With the ball, he grabbed ten wickets with best figures of 3/31 against Lucknow Super Giants. It is a relief for the Englishman that his IPL campaign didn’t bomb, unlike some of his predecessors.

Ishan Kishan – IPL 2022 Auction

In the IPL 2022 auction, wicketkeeper-batter Ishan Kishan became the most expensive player at the auction, with a price tag of ₹15.25 crore, which was paid to him by the Mumbai Indians. So, how did he fare? Ishan was his franchise’s top run-scorer with 418 runs at an average of 32. He scored three fifties, which included an 81 against Delhi Capitals at Wankhede. However, Mumbai Indians failed to reach the playoffs after finishing bottom of the points table.

Chris Morris – IPL 2021 Auction

Chris Morris set the auction tables on fire in the 2021 season. Rajasthan Royals snapped Morris for ₹16.25 crore. The Proteas all-rounder had a decent IPL 14. He took 15 wickets in 11 outings, finishing the season as the Royals’ highest wicket-taker. Against Kolkata Knight Riders in Mumbai, Morris grabbed four wickets for 23 runs. However, he didn’t make much impact with the bat, scoring just 67 runs in seven innings.

Pat Cummins – IPL 2020 Auction

Australia fast bowler Pat Cummins grabbed the headlines in the IPL 2020 auction. Kolkata Knight Riders bought him for ₹15.5 crore. He played in all 14 matches for the franchise in the 2020 season. The pacer struggled for consistency and had to settle for just 12 wickets in the season. But Cummins made some impact with the bat as he scored a half-century in the tournament.

 Jaydev Unadkat & Varun Chakravarthy – IPL 2019 Auction

In the 2019 auctions, Jaydev Unadkat and Varun Chakravarthy were the most expensive players. Rajasthan Royals and Punjab Kings (then Kings XI Punjab) shelled out ₹8.4 crore for Unadkat and Chakravarthy, respectively. The left-arm pacer played 11 games in which he accounted for ten wickets. Rajasthan Royals failed to reach the playoffs. On the other hand, Chakravarthy’s season was marred by a finger injury. He only featured in KKR’s second game of the 2019 edition and was sidelined for the rest of the campaign.  

Concluding Thoughts

IPL 2020 and 2023’s most expensive players, Cummins and Curran, struggled, while Ishan and Morris did a decent job despite their franchises failing to pick up points consistently. What is clear is that there are no guarantees that the most expensive players will be the best performers in the season.
